On Thu Oct 30, 2025 at 12:44 PM CET, Shannon Sterz wrote:
>> @@ -560,6 +564,7 @@ pub async fn get_status(  pub async fn 
>> get_subscription_status(
>>      max_age: u64,
>>      verbose: bool,
>> +    view_filter: Option<String>,
>>      rpcenv: &mut dyn RpcEnvironment,
>>  ) -> Result<Vec<RemoteSubscriptions>, Error> {
>>      let (remotes_config, _) = pdm_config::remotes::config()?; @@ 
>> -572,6 +577,14 @@ pub async fn get_subscription_status(
>>          .check_privs(&auth_id, &["resources"], PRIV_RESOURCE_AUDIT, false)
>>          .is_ok();
>>
>> +    if let Some(view_filter) = &view_filter {
>> +        user_info.check_privs(&auth_id, &["view", view_filter], PRIV_RESOURCE_AUDIT, false)?;
>> +    }
>
> this is minor, but maybe consider moving the view check before the 
> `allow_all` check and skipping the `allow_all` check (by setting it to
> false) if a view was found. that should safe us an unecessary 
> traversal of the acl tree here.
>
> i think wolfgang already noted that tho.
>

ack, will be fixed for the next iteration.

>> +
>> +    let view_filter = view_filter
>> +        .map(|filter_name| views::view_filter::get_view_filter(&filter_name))
>> +        .transpose()?;
>> +
>>      let check_priv = |remote_name: &str| -> bool {
>>          user_info
>>              .check_privs(
>> @@ -584,35 +597,62 @@ pub async fn get_subscription_status(
>>      };
>>
>>      for (remote_name, remote) in remotes_config {
>> -        if !allow_all && !check_priv(&remote_name) {
>> +        if let Some(filter) = &view_filter {
>> +            if filter.can_skip_remote(&remote_name) {
>> +                continue;
>> +            }
>> +        } else if !allow_all && !check_priv(&remote_name) {
>>              continue;
>>          }
>>
>> +        let view_filter_clone = view_filter.clone();
>> +
>>          let future = async move {
>>              let (node_status, error) =
>>                  match get_subscription_info_for_remote(&remote, max_age).await {
>> -                    Ok(node_status) => (Some(node_status), None),
>> +                    Ok(mut node_status) => {
>> +                        node_status.retain(|node, _| {
>> +                            if let Some(filter) = &view_filter_clone {
>> +                                filter.is_node_included(&remote.id, node)
>> +                            } else {
>> +                                true
>> +                            }
>> +                        });
>> +                        (Some(node_status), None)
>> +                    }
>>                      Err(error) => (None, Some(error.to_string())),
>>                  };
>>
>> -            let mut state = RemoteSubscriptionState::Unknown;
>> +            let state = if let Some(node_status) = &node_status {
>> +                if error.is_some() {
>> +                    // Don't leak the existence of failed remotes, since we cannot apply
>> +                    // view-filters here.
>> +                    return None;
>
> shouldn't this be gated by checking if view_filters was defined?
> otherwise we now return nothing every time we get an error?
>
> also correct me if i'm wrong, but isn't this `return None;` unreachable?
> error is assigned `Some` iff the `get_subscription_status` call above 
> returns an `Err`, but in that case `node_status` is set to `None`, so 
> the `if let Some(node_status) = &node_status` above should be false?
>

Excellent catch! You are absolutely right, I think I can just drop the if-clause completely. Thanks a lot!

>> +                }
>>
>> -            if let Some(node_status) = &node_status {
>> -                state = map_node_subscription_list_to_state(node_status);
>> -            }
>> +                if node_status.is_empty() {
>> +                    return None;
>> +                }
>>
>> -            RemoteSubscriptions {
>> +                map_node_subscription_list_to_state(node_status)
>> +            } else {
>> +                RemoteSubscriptionState::Unknown
>> +            };
>> +
>> +            Some(RemoteSubscriptions {
>>                  remote: remote_name,
>>                  error,
>>                  state,
>>                  node_status: if verbose { node_status } else { None },
>> -            }
>> +            })
>>          };
>>
>>          futures.push(future);
>>      }
>>
>> -    Ok(join_all(futures).await)
>> +    let status = 
>> + join_all(futures).await.into_iter().flatten().collect();
>> +
>> +    Ok(status)
>>  }
>>
>>  // FIXME: make timeframe and count parameters?
